He was famous for Blade runner and changed the dying words of his android character, "I have seen fires over orions belt" speech, which were far better than the original Script. That made his character so memorable.

After that he did a lot of 'B' and 'C' si-fi movies, mostly 'after the end of the world/apocalyptic' type movies, to make ends meet. Some were actually quite good.
